- OPT (DSTD) DSTA DID call to Second Degree Busy treatment (denied)
allowed.
If allowed, DID calls forwarded to a busy set are
disconnected.
If denied, calls forwarded to a busy set follow the set’s CLS
(FBA/FBD) treatment.
